Rename create/delete transform methods

CreateTransportModeTransform and DeleteTransportModeTransform are both
agnostic as far as which mode of transform it creates/deletes. As such,
to facilitate the implementation of tunnel mode, this patch renames them
to CreateTransform and DeleteTransform, along with all test names.

Bug: 63588681
Test: frameworks/base unit tests and CTS tests run, passed
Change-Id: I1f015eb7ad0e85fca966658a9402485ca2b44091
This commit is contained in:
Benedict Wong
2018-01-18 14:38:16 -08:00
parent 0d483b76f3
commit 0fff56eae5
3 changed files with 8 additions and 9 deletions

View File

@@ -39,9 +39,9 @@ interface IIpSecService
void closeUdpEncapsulationSocket(int resourceId);
IpSecTransformResponse createTransportModeTransform(in IpSecConfig c, in IBinder binder);
IpSecTransformResponse createTransform(in IpSecConfig c, in IBinder binder);
void deleteTransportModeTransform(int transformId);
void deleteTransform(int transformId);
void applyTransportModeTransform(in ParcelFileDescriptor socket, int direction, int transformId);

View File

@@ -124,8 +124,7 @@ public final class IpSecTransform implements AutoCloseable {
synchronized (this) {
try {
IIpSecService svc = getIpSecService();
IpSecTransformResponse result =
svc.createTransportModeTransform(mConfig, new Binder());
IpSecTransformResponse result = svc.createTransform(mConfig, new Binder());
int status = result.status;
checkResultStatus(status);
mResourceId = result.resourceId;
@@ -170,7 +169,7 @@ public final class IpSecTransform implements AutoCloseable {
* still want to clear out the transform.
*/
IIpSecService svc = getIpSecService();
svc.deleteTransportModeTransform(mResourceId);
svc.deleteTransform(mResourceId);
stopKeepalive();
} catch (RemoteException e) {
throw e.rethrowAsRuntimeException();